Trump International Scotland Wins Triple Honor at World Golf Awards
News Summary
Trump International Scotland secured a remarkable triple honor at the 12th annual World Golf Awards, with its New Course being named ‘World’s Best Golf Course 2025’ and ‘Europe’s Best New Golf Course 2025’. Additionally, it received the award for ‘World’s Best Contribution to Golf Tourism Hospitality 2025’. The New Course, opened in 2024, is praised for its innovative design, contributing to Scotland’s reputation in the golfing world.

A Grand Design
The New Course has been designed with precision, aiming to complement the existing Championship Course at Trump International, resulting in a spectacular 36 holes of world-class golf. Staging Championships
Trump International was busy on the competitive front as well, witnessing thrilling tournaments over the past year. Notable events, such as the Staysure PGA Seniors Championship and the DP World Nexo Championship, have showcased the course’s ability to host world-class competitions, further cementing its status in the golf circuit.
